About this map

Santa Paula Creek carves a deep path through the southern reaches of the Los Padres National Forest in this early 1950s survey. The landscape is defined by the sharp transition from the residential and agricultural outskirts of Santa Paula to the steep, fuel-rich canyons of the Santa Paula Ridge. Industrial activity is evident throughout the southern foothills, where numerous oil wells, oil tanks, and a quarry signal the extraction economy of the era.
